Not all probate sales require court approval.
This video explains the difference between Independent Administration of Estates Act (IAEA )full authority and court-confirmation probate sales with limited authority, and how each impacts the sale of inherited real estate in California and Sonoma County. One requires court confirmation of sale and has limitations for the sale, while the other is straight forward and does not require the court approval or requirements.
